How it works

A small transactional flow for one missed call.

1

Your line rings you first

A dedicated business number forwards every call straight to you, exactly like your calls work today.

2

Missed call, instant text

If you cannot pick up, the caller receives one branded text within seconds instead of a voicemail dead end.

3

Details collected

The conversation asks three quick questions: the job, the service area, and a callback window.

4

You get the lead

A concise summary lands in your texts, with the full conversation waiting in your dashboard.

FAQ

Short answers before you join.

Is this a marketing platform?

No. Missed Call Rescue only sends transactional missed-call recovery texts about a call the customer just made to your business. There are no campaigns, promotions, or bulk messages.

How do I join the pilot?

Email us using the contact link below and we will onboard your business personally. We set up your dedicated line, service area, and text-back copy with you. There is no self-serve signup or online checkout during the pilot.

What does the caller receive?

A short text that says you missed their call, asks what they need help with, and explains how to opt out. The flow asks for the service, the location, and a callback window, then stops.

What happens when a caller replies STOP?

They are opted out for your line immediately. The app stops prompting them and keeps a record so later texts stay suppressed until they opt back in with START.

Can I control the replies?

Yes. You can call back directly, or send a one-off reply from your dashboard. The automated flow only ever asks the three lead questions.

Do I need to change my phone number?

No. During the pilot you get a dedicated tracking number that forwards to your existing phone. Using your current published number directly is planned for after the pilot.
